About Palekastron

Palekastron, a serene village located on the eastern coast of Crete, offers a blend of natural beauty and cultural experiences. One of the highlights of Palekastron is its stunning beaches, particularly the long stretch of sandy coastline at Kouremenos Beach. This beach is ideal for sunbathing and swimming, and it is also popular among windsurfers due to the favorable wind conditions.

Another significant aspect of the area is its archaeological sites. The nearby ruins of the ancient city of Itanos provide insight into the region's rich history. Visitors can explore the remnants of ancient structures and enjoy the picturesque views of the coast.

For those interested in local culture, Palekastron has a number of traditional tavernas that serve authentic Cretan cuisine. Sampling local dishes made from fresh ingredients is an essential experience, as it reflects the culinary heritage of the region.

Nature lovers may appreciate the surrounding landscapes, including the nearby mountains and olive groves. Hiking trails in the vicinity offer opportunities to explore the natural environment, providing a chance to see the diverse flora and fauna of Crete.

Moreover, the village hosts occasional cultural events which showcase local music and dance, giving visitors a taste of Cretan traditions. Engaging with the local community during these events can enhance the travel experience and provide a deeper understanding of the area.

In summary, Palekastron offers a mix of beach activities, historical exploration, culinary delights, and cultural engagement, making it a pleasant destination for those looking to experience the quieter side of Crete.
